      Jerry has my Wagonaire roof rack now and several other Wagonaire parts for plating. He does EXCELLENT work at reasonable prices (a hard combo to find). Pot metal is easy to ruin in the plating process, but Jerry knows what he is doing and does it right. He did ALL the plating on the Kart Hauler...
